package migrate

import (
"context"
"encoding/base64"
"fmt"
"strconv"
"strings"
"sync/atomic"
"time"

"github.com/transparency-dev/trillian-tessera/api/layout"
"github.com/transparency-dev/trillian-tessera/client"
"golang.org/x/sync/errgroup"
"k8s.io/klog/v2"
)

type migrate struct {
storage MigrationStorage
getCP client.CheckpointFetcherFunc
getTile client.TileFetcherFunc
getEntries client.EntryBundleFetcherFunc

todo chan span

tilesToMigrate uint64
bundlesToMigrate uint64
tilesMigrated atomic.Uint64
bundlesMigrated atomic.Uint64
}

// span represents the number of tiles at a given tile-level.
type span struct {
level int
start uint64
N uint64
}

type MigrationStorage interface {
SetTile(ctx context.Context, level, index uint64, partial uint8, tile []byte) error
SetEntryBundle(ctx context.Context, index uint64, partial uint8, bundle []byte) error
SetState(ctx context.Context, treeSize uint64, rootHash []byte) error
}

func Migrate(ctx context.Context, stateDB string, getCP client.CheckpointFetcherFunc, getTile client.TileFetcherFunc, getEntries client.EntryBundleFetcherFunc, storage MigrationStorage) error {
// TODO store state & resume
m := &migrate{
storage: storage,
getCP: getCP,
getTile: getTile,
getEntries: getEntries,
todo: make(chan span, 100),
}

// init
cp, err := getCP(ctx)
if err != nil {
return fmt.Errorf("fetch initial source checkpoint: %v", err)
}
bits := strings.Split(string(cp), "\n")
size, err := strconv.ParseUint(bits[1], 10, 64)
if err != nil {
return fmt.Errorf("invalid CP size %q: %v", bits[1], err)
}
rootHash, err := base64.StdEncoding.DecodeString(bits[2])
if err != nil {
return fmt.Errorf("invalid checkpoint roothash %q: %v", bits[2], err)
}

// figure out what needs copying
go m.populateSpans(size)

// Print stats
go func() {
for {
time.Sleep(time.Second)
tn := m.tilesMigrated.Load()
tnp := float64(tn*100) / float64(m.tilesToMigrate)
bn := m.bundlesMigrated.Load()
bnp := float64(tn*100) / float64(m.bundlesToMigrate)
klog.Infof("tiles: %d (%.2f%%) bundles: %d (%.2f%%)", tn, tnp, bn, bnp)
}
}()

// Do the copying
eg := errgroup.Group{}
for i := 0; i < 1000; i++ {
eg.Go(func() error {
return m.migrateRange(ctx)

})
}
if err := eg.Wait(); err != nil {
return fmt.Errorf("migrate failed to copy resources: %v", err)
}
return storage.SetState(ctx, size, rootHash)
}

func calcExpectedCounts(treeSize uint64) (uint64, uint64) {
tiles := uint64(0)
bundles := uint64(0)
levelSize := treeSize
for level := 0; levelSize > 0; level++ {
numFull, partial := levelSize/layout.TileWidth, levelSize%layout.TileWidth
n := numFull
if partial > 0 {
n++
}
tiles += n
if level == 0 {
bundles = n
}
levelSize >>= layout.TileHeight
}
return tiles, bundles
}

func (m *migrate) populateSpans(treeSize uint64) {
m.tilesToMigrate, m.bundlesToMigrate = calcExpectedCounts(treeSize)
klog.Infof("Spans for treeSize %d", treeSize)
klog.Infof("total resources to fetch %d tiles + %d bundles = %d", m.tilesToMigrate, m.bundlesToMigrate, m.tilesToMigrate+m.bundlesToMigrate)

levelSize := treeSize
for level := 0; levelSize > 0; level++ {
numFull, partial := levelSize/layout.TileWidth, levelSize%layout.TileWidth
for j := uint64(0); j < numFull; j++ {
m.todo <- span{level: level, start: j, N: layout.TileWidth}
if level == 0 {
m.todo <- span{level: -1, start: j, N: layout.TileWidth}
}
}
if partial > 0 {
m.todo <- span{level: level, start: numFull, N: partial}
if level == 0 {
m.todo <- span{level: -1, start: numFull, N: partial}
}

}
levelSize >>= layout.TileHeight
}
close(m.todo)
}

func (m *migrate) migrateRange(ctx context.Context) error {
for s := range m.todo {
if s.N == layout.TileWidth {
s.N = 0
}
if s.level == -1 {
d, err := m.getEntries(ctx, s.start, uint8(s.N))
if err != nil {
return fmt.Errorf("failed to fetch entrybundle %d (p=%d): %v", s.start, s.N, err)
}
if err := m.storage.SetEntryBundle(ctx, s.start, uint8(s.N), d); err != nil {
return fmt.Errorf("failed to store entrybundle %d (p=%d): %v", s.start, s.N, err)
}
m.bundlesMigrated.Add(1)
} else {
d, err := m.getTile(ctx, uint64(s.level), s.start, uint8(s.N))
if err != nil {
return fmt.Errorf("failed to fetch tile level %d index %d (p=%d): %v", s.level, s.start, s.N, err)
}
if err := m.storage.SetTile(ctx, uint64(s.level), s.start, uint8(s.N), d); err != nil {
return fmt.Errorf("failed to store tile level %d index %d (p=%d): %v", s.level, s.start, s.N, err)
}
m.tilesMigrated.Add(1)
}
}
return nil
}
